Output 3c59ec24a1f18b49be38a0d3eb1f0ad9607075bfb3da7f9e6e94a096a1bd4b47:0

value
129778305
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 1e6734498ad3139126e40767a79c1e31d945725b OP_EQUALVERIFY OP_CHECKSIG
address
13mkuWgRE872Ew3fQ3srGx19UYfK4Xf2U8
transaction
3c59ec24a1f18b49be38a0d3eb1f0ad9607075bfb3da7f9e6e94a096a1bd4b47
spent
true